Enables P-type sodium:potassium-exchanging transporter activity and protein heterodimerization activity. Predicted to be involved in several processes, including cellular monovalent inorganic cation homeostasis; ion transmembrane transport; and positive regulation of cation transmembrane transport. Predicted to act upstream of or within several processes, including brain development; motor behavior; and photoreceptor cell maintenance. Located in apical plasma membrane. Part of sodium:potassium-exchanging ATPase complex. Orthologous to human ATP1B2 (ATPase Na+/K+ transporting subunit beta 2). [provided by Alliance of Genome Resources, Apr 2022]
